'/ json / order'的NoMethodError

时间:2013-12-25 17:06:29

标签: ruby json knockout.js sinatra

我正在尝试从knockout.js发布一些JSON。我相信我正在从适当的时候获得数据,因为我在Console中的POST看起来是这样的:

[{"quantity":1,"item":"Enchiladas"}]

我的回答看起来像这样:

<title>NoMethodError at &#x2F;json&#x2F;order</title>

我正在尝试使用以下代码将JSON解析为ruby哈希:

post '/json/order' do
  request.body.rewind
  @data = JSON.parse request.body.read
end

0 个答案:

没有答案